+static bool vhost_svq_more_used_packed(VhostShadowVirtqueue *svq)
+{
+    bool avail_flag, used_flag, used_wrap_counter;
+    uint16_t last_used_idx, last_used, flags;
+
+    last_used_idx = svq->last_used_idx;
+    last_used = last_used_idx & ~(1 << VRING_PACKED_EVENT_F_WRAP_CTR);

In the linux kernel, last_used is calculated as:

last_used_idx & ~(-(1 << VRING_PACKED_EVENT_F_WRAP_CTR))

...instead of...

last_used_idx & ~(1 << VRING_PACKED_EVENT_F_WRAP_CTR)

Isn't the second option good enough if last_used_idx is uint16_t
and VRING_PACKED_EVENT_F_WRAP_CTR is defined as 15.


I think it is good enough with the u16 restrictions but it's just
defensive code.


Got it. I think it'll be better then to follow the implementation in
the kernel to keep it more robust.

Also in the implementation of vhost_svq_more_used_split() [1], I haven't
understood why the following condition:

svq->last_used_idx != svq->shadow_used_idx

is checked before updating the value of "svq->shadow_used_idx":

svq->shadow_used_idx = le16_to_cpu(*(volatile uint16_t *)used_idx)


As far as I know this is used to avoid concurrent access to guest's
used_idx, avoiding cache sharing, the memory barrier, and the
potentially costly volatile access.


By concurrent access, do you mean in case one thread has already updated
the value of used_idx?
